PM to visit China late June

Prime Minister of Bangladesh, Tarique Rahman, is expected to visit China in late June, 2026, on his second official state visit since forming the government. 

The visit is expected to further strengthen Bangladesh-China bilateral relations and open a new chapter in their comprehensive strategic cooperation, said Deputy Speaker Kaiser Kamal on Thursday, June 11, 2026.

He made the remarks while delivering a speech at the 7th China-South Asia Cooperation Forum held in Kunming, China’s Yunnan Province.

In his address, the Deputy Speaker highlighted the historical background of long-standing diplomatic relations between Bangladesh and China. 

He noted that the visits of Shaheed President Ziaur Rahman to China in 1977 and 1980 laid a stronger foundation for bilateral ties. He also mentioned that former PM Khaleda Zia’s visits to China in 1991 and 2002 elevated the relationship to a new level.
